科学上网是很多用户的迫切需求,尤其是在需要访问国外网站和服务的情况下。自搭梯子成为了许多人解决浏览限制的一种热门方式。本文将详细介绍科学上网自搭梯子的具体实践过程,涵盖从搭建环境到使用工具的方方面面。
目录
- 什么是科学上网与自搭梯子
- 自搭梯子的基本概念
- 搭建自己的VPN
- 使用Vultr搭建VPN
- 使用Shadowsocks
- 搭建SSH通道
- 优化和配置
- 防火墙设置
- 连接设置方案
- 常见问题解答(FAQ)
- 总结
1. 什么是科学上网与自搭梯子
在我们深入了解之前,首先需要定义科学上网和自搭梯子。
1.1 科学上网
科学上网指的是通过某些技术手段,帮助用户能够访问在其所在地无法正常访问的互联网内容,如国外的网站、应用程序。此类技术手段包括但不限于VPN、代理和SS等。
1.2 自搭梯子
自搭梯子特指用户自主搭建的翻墙工具,常见的有VPS上搭建的VPN服务。其优点在于自主管控、成本相对较低,数据的安全性相对提高。
2. 自搭梯子的基本概念
在自搭梯子的过程中,我们通常会使用以下常用工具和协议:
- VPN(虚拟专用网)
- Shadowsocks
- SSH(安全外壳协议)
- Tunneling(通道技术)
前往虚拟主机服务厂商,根据自己的需求选择合适的购买套餐。【在国内,推荐使用Vultr、Linode等互联网公司。】
3. 搭建自己的VPN
3.1 使用Vultr搭建VPN
-
注册并购买VPS
- 访问Vultr官网,创建账户并按照期待速度及数据中心>buiybuy设置相应的VPS。
-
登录SSH
- 使用PuTTY等工具连接到VPS的IP地址。
-
安装OpenVPN
- 通过运行以下命令安装OpenVPN:
bash
sudo apt-get update
sudo apt-get -y install openvpn
- 通过运行以下命令安装OpenVPN:
-
配置服务器和客户
- 运行OpenVPN配置命令生成SSL证书及集中申办。
-
前台VPN连接
- 使用OpenVPN client连接到服务端。
3.2 使用Shadowsocks
-
购买VPS
- 推荐Linux系统简繁运维如CentOS环境。
-
开启并登录SSH
-
安装Shadowsocks
- 使用以下指令安装:
bash
pip install shadowsocks
- 使用以下指令安装:
-
配置Shadowsocks
- 需要创建配置文件ss.json,设置好端口和密码等参数。
-
启动Shadowsocks服务
- 运行启动命令:
bash
ssserver -c /etc/shadowsocks.json -d start
- 运行启动命令:
4. 搭建SSH通道
-
购买VPS
在上本部分确保你已正确使用VPS结构。 -
通过SSH建立
使用下述指令创建SSH通路:
bash
ssh -D 1080 user@remote_host -
使用Putty将本机连接设置为SOCKS5代理
这样在本机上设置代理映射,更加简单直观。
5. 优化和配置
5.1 防火墙设置
确保适当开通你所服务的端口:
- 例如,使端口
80
和443
打开。
5.2 连接设置方案
建议记录包括连接断点及出现故障,加速配置有效调试。
6. 常见问题解答(FAQ)
Q1: 自搭梯子是否安全?
自搭梯子安全性受您使用的方法和服务所决定。一般说来,自搭梯子比使用公共VPN更安全,因为数据不经过第三方。这是你掌控自己的数据。
Q2: 为什么我的连接速度慢?
连接速度慢的重要原因可能是在网络质量较差的情况下:
- 地区距离:试图服务器距离过远,建议选择较邻近的地点。
- 带宽限制:虚拟主机成本与网络带宽相关,如果场地速度慢,应考虑更换或升级。
Q3: 如果我丢失了VPS管接口,怎么办?
您可以通过您购买的商家的支持寻找相应解决,例如确认注册邮件中的账号信息。
7. 总结
科学上网自搭梯子不仅可以让我们在限制的网络环境中使用互联网,更为我们的上网活动提供了更高的隐私保障。然而,在使用不同的技术手段时,请务必认真配置与保护信息数据,才能让我们的网络%。
总而言之,自搭梯子的过程将十分有效果,对于个人用户,相较于私人VPN是一个更加固态重要选择,愿每一位小认为科技的使用而收获网fz处收益。